- Mason Moran was the top QB today. He threw a very catchable ball and has a very quick release.
- Very impressed with new WR's Trevon Bradford and Timmy Hernandez. Those two could give the current group a run for their money. Bradford was also being utilized as a punt returner as well.
- Several guys sat out today: Paul Lucas, Damien Haskins, Sean Harlow, Gavin Andrews, Rahmel Dockery, Caleb Smith, and Cyril Noland-Lewis are some of the notable players that I jotted down. Harlow, Smith and Andrews have not practiced all spring. I spoke to Harlow in passing on his way to the bus. He has been getting rehab on his foot/ankle and fully expects to be ready to go this fall. He said he should be able to ditch the scooter 'soon'.
- Ryan Nall is a beast. It was a scrimmage and he ran hard all afternoon. Tim Cook is also pretty impressive. Both give the Beavers a totally different look than what we've seen in the past at RB. Kyle White shows some speed, but needs to work on catching the ball out of the backfield.
